Thunder in alpha release

It's been a few intensive weeks developing Thunder.
and finally, we're there. we've got the most important features.
the engine's working fine :

we can convert our PDF files to audio MP3 using Thunder.

....But we still need to undergo some extensive tests and correct some quirks with the User Interface before moving to beta release ...

We hope Thunder is going to be a great tool for all the students out there looking for a way to reduce their on-screen time and help them maximize the use of their time by taking their lessons (on PDF files) with them everywhere.
